Raven's co-operate to hunt Lizards.

An interesting story on the BBC website today.

It appears that Brown Necked Ravens team up to hunt lizards.

Two of the Ravens ly to the ground to block the lizard's escape route, while the others attacked it.

This would seem to suggest that the birds must know what each other and the lizard are thinking, known as a 'theory of mind', say the scientists.
